FIN 5510 - Investment Products

Institution:
Utah Valley University
Subject:
Finance
Description:
Prerequisite(s): Permission of instructor or department chair and University Advanced Standing. Helps students prepare for the CFA Level I exam by analyzing investment products. Defines major investment and sub-types of equity investments, fixed income investments, derivatives, and alternative investments. Introduces essential features and related risks of investment products.
